Product reviews:
Nigel
2025-08-05 iphone Xs
LEGO 76131 Avengers Compound Battle lego avengers endgame avengers compound battle
lego avengers endgame avengers compound battle
Taylor
2025-08-02 iphone 7 Plus
Avengers: Endgame lego avengers endgame avengers compound battle
lego avengers endgame avengers compound battle
LEGO Set 76131-1 Avengers Compound lego avengers endgame avengers compound battle
lego avengers endgame avengers compound battle
Hayden
2025-08-10 iphone 7
Marvel's Avengers: Endgame Compound lego avengers endgame avengers compound battle
lego avengers endgame avengers compound battle